APC Power Solutions cover a wide range of requirements. The more mission-critical the application, the higher the necessity for as little downtime as possible, mandating continued operation through outages of any length. Some organizations might not require such high availability, but require automatic, safe shutdown of important software and operating systems, keeping important data secure. Any power solution should, at the very least, prevent physical damage to hardware from transients (surges, spikes, sags, etc.).
Smart-UPS® VT
Performance power protection with scalable runtime for small data centers
Range: 10 to 40kVA in 400V, 10 to 30kVA in 208V and 20 to 30kVA in 480V
Smart-UPS® VT offers centralized three-phase power protection with the reliability of the award winning Smart-UPS family. Ideal for small data centers, large retail stores, regional offices, and dense power requirements, the Smart-UPS VT includes dual-mains input, automatic and maintenance bypasses, and scalable runtime with hot-swappable batteries for increased availability. Low cost of ownership is achieved through best-inclass efficiency and a reduction in rating of electrical infrastructure (wires, transformers, and generators) due to Smart-UPS VT's Soft Start feature.
APC's Network Management Card with temperature monitoring provides remote monitoring and management through a simple Web/SNMP interface and provides integration with InfraStruXureTM Manager. Serviceability is greatly enhanced by user-replaceable batteries, manageable extended run frames and included startup and standard onsite warranty services. All of these features make Smart-UPS VT the easiest UPS in its class to deploy, manage and maintain.

Symmetra® PX
High-performance, redundant power protection with scalable power and runtime for data centers
Range: 10-80kW N+1
Symmetra® PX, three-phase input/three-phase output (3:3), is a single unit,composed of modular components. This modular architecture provides the foundation of building and scaling near-continuous availability power systems with a flexible range of power capacity. The Symmetra PX packages the high availability requirements of easy power and runtime scalability into a very small footprint.

Silcon®
Performance power protection with scalable runtime for data centers and facilities
Range: 40 to 80kW in 208V, 10 to 500kW in 480V and 60 to 480 kW in 400V
The APC Silcon® Series has the load capacity to serve a broad range of electrical equipment, from mainframe computers to large corporation-wide installations, production lines, electronic control systems and telecommunication equipment. Up to nine Silcon units can be paralleled to serve special demands for power upgrading or redundancy.

Advanced power management
Silcon's intelligent control system can be programmed to maximise the overall efficiency of parallel Delta Conversion On-line systems. By designating as "active" only the systems needed to supply the load will be on-line, the other systems can be held in "stand-by" mode, ready to start up without interruption when required. Furthermore, to reduce stress and improve reliability, the load can be switched between the parallel systems in preprogrammed sequences.
Lower cost of ownership
The APC Silcon Series is higher in efficiency than other on-line technologies. The Delta Conversion On-line units simply do not consume large quantities of energy and also produce much less heat. Customers need not oversize an air-conditioning unit to compensate for the heat loss which traditional UPSs generate.
Lower installation cost
The APC Silcon Series has a power factor corrected input, ensuring that the input power factor is always one, regardless of load and utility voltage. A power factor of one minimises installation costs by requiring smaller cables and smaller fuses.
Eliminates wear and tear on electrical infrastructure
Utilities and power distributors are creating standards to limit the harmonic distortion produced by users. Violating these standards can be very costly. Many double-conversion 3-phase systems produce a level of harmonic distortion high enough to negatively impact the utility and its customers. To remedy the situation, customers are obliged to install large expensive filters. These filters further diminish the overall efficiency of the double-conversion machine. The Delta Conversion On-line technology, which maintains a sinusoidal utility current, eliminates this 3-phase double conversion topology problem.
Complient with power supplies, for the present and the future (kVA = kW)
Over the past three years, more and more computer manufacturers have built Power Factor Corrected (PFC) power supplies into their servers. In order to avoid unnecessary wear and tear on computer components, the Volt-Amps (VA) requirements of all the computers that make up the load need to equal the Watts (W) capacity of the UPS.
The APC Silcon Series is PFC compliant without derating the unit. Double-conversion 3-phase UPS systems are not PFC compliant. Therefore, as more and more PFC computers enter into your datacentre, there is an increasing probalitity that the legacy double-conversion 3-phase UPSs become overloaded. With the APC Silcon Series, this problem is eliminated because the kVA rating of the unit equals the kW rating.
